titleOfInvention |
Electro-optical device, electronic apparatus, and manufacturing method of electro-optical device |
abstract |
A display region E that includes an element isolation region 88 having a display region trench density D 1 , and in which a pixel circuit 110 including a transistor is arranged; a drive circuit region 105 that includes a region in which a drive circuit element isolation portion having a drive circuit region trench density D 2 is provided, and in which drive circuits 101 and 102 that supply signals for driving the pixel circuit 110 are arranged; and a peripheral region 106 that includes region in which a peripheral element isolation portion having a peripheral region trench density D 3 is provided, and is arranged at least between the display region E and the drive circuit region 105 . The display region trench density D 1 is different from the drive circuit region trench density D 2 , and the display region trench density D 1 is equal to the peripheral region trench density D 3. |
